Enduring Capability Domains vs Tool-Specific Knowledge
One of the most important modern IT concepts is separating:
- enduring operational concepts from
- current implementation technologies
For example:
| Capability Domain | Example Implementations |
|---|---|
| Infrastructure Automation | Terraform, Bicep, CloudFormation |
| Observability | Grafana, Datadog, Splunk |
| Container Orchestration | Kubernetes, ECS, OpenShift |
| Identity & Access Management | AWS IAM, Entra ID, Okta |
| CI/CD & Release Engineering | GitHub Actions, GitLab, Jenkins |
The goal is not to train personnel only on tools.
The goal is to build adaptable operators who understand:
- operational concepts
- workflows
- risks
- troubleshooting patterns
- customer impact
- automation thinking
This allows organizations to evolve technologies without rebuilding the entire workforce capability model.

Knowledge vs Execution
Modern cloud training should validate both:
- Knowledge
- Execution
Knowledge answers:
Do they understand the concept?
Execution answers:
Can they safely perform the task in our environment?
For example:
A person may understand CI/CD concepts conceptually, but operational readiness requires the ability to:
- navigate the deployment pipeline
- review logs
- identify failures
- perform rollback procedures
- follow approval workflows
- communicate operational status
Modern cloud operations require both understanding and execution.
Operational Judgment
One of the most overlooked skills in IT operations is operational judgment.
Modern cloud operators must know:
- when to escalate
- how to communicate risk
- how to avoid unsafe actions
- how to prioritize incidents
- how to coordinate during outages
- how customer impact changes operational decisions
This is where organizations mature beyond simple technical training.

AI-Augmented Operations
AI is becoming part of modern cloud operations.
Cloud operators increasingly use:
- AI-assisted troubleshooting
- AI-generated documentation
- AI copilots
- AI-assisted scripting
- AI-supported operational workflows
Organizations should prepare personnel to:
- use AI responsibly
- validate AI-generated outputs
- recognize hallucinations and inaccuracies
- understand data sensitivity concerns
- understand governance and acceptable use expectations
AI literacy is becoming a foundational operational competency.
